Description:
I can change whether a column is autoincremented or not in the jdbcDriverOOo[1]
driver.

When changing this option, by the drop-down list which depends on the column
which is selected, if we validate the changes by the Save button (Ctr + S)
while then did not take care to click again in the list of columns then the
changes are saved but Base will ask you to save again before closing.

If after changing the auto value option, I click in the list of columns (it
doesn't matter which one) and I save using the Save button then when I close
this window, Base does not ask me anything...

Steps to Reproduce:
1. Edit a table in Base.
2. Try to modify the auto value option
3. Save and exit the table editing window
4. When you exit Base asks you to save again.

Actual Results:
Base asks to save the changes even though it has just been done.


Expected Results:
Base don't asks to save the changes.


Reproducible: Always


User Profile Reset: No

Additional Info:
If just before saving using the Save button you make sure to put the cursor
back in the column grid (with a click on one of the columns) then everything
will work correctly.
